1. Italy: A Timeless Blend of Art, History, and Gastronomy
Italy remains an undisputed titan in the world of tourism, consistently offering unparalleled experiences for every type of traveler. Its enduring appeal lies in its extraordinary concentration of art, history, and culture, seamlessly interwoven with impressive landscapes and a world-renowned culinary tradition. For 2026-2027, Italy continues to draw visitors seeking a deep connection with the past while enjoying the vibrant present.
Art and Architecture: A Living Museum
From the Renaissance masterpieces of Florence to the ancient wonders of Rome and the unique canals of Venice, Italy is a living museum. Visitors can wander through the Colosseum, marvel at Michelangelo’s David, explore the ruins of Pompeii, and get lost in the artistic heritage of cities like Milan and Naples. The sheer volume of UNESCO World Heritage sites—more than any other country—underscores its historical significance.
Culinary Journeys: Beyond Pasta and Pizza
Italian cuisine is a cornerstone of its tourist experience. Beyond the globally loved pasta and pizza, regional specialties offer a diverse gastronomic adventure. Think of the rich risottos of the north, the fresh seafood of the Amalfi Coast, the robust flavors of Tuscany, and the unique pastries of Sicily. Food tours, cooking classes, and wine tastings are integral to understanding Italian culture.
Diverse Landscapes: From Alps to Mediterranean Shores
Italy’s geography is remarkably varied. The dramatic peaks of the Dolomites offer world-class skiing and hiking, while the rolling hills of Tuscany provide picturesque vineyards and olive groves. The country’s extensive coastline features stunning beaches, charming fishing villages, and iconic islands like Sardinia and Sicily, each with its own distinct character and appeal.
Planning Your Italian Adventure in 2026-2027
When planning for 2026-2027, consider visiting during the shoulder seasons (spring: April-May, autumn: September-October) to avoid peak crowds and enjoy pleasant weather. Key experiences include exploring Rome’s ancient sites, enjoying a gondola ride in Venice, visiting Florence’s art galleries, and savoring regional wines in Tuscany. For a truly in-depth experience, consider a multi-city itinerary or focusing on a specific region.
2. Japan: Where Tradition Meets Futuristic Innovation
Japan offers a travel experience unlike any other, characterized by its unique fusion of ancient traditions and modern modernity. This interesting duality makes it a perennial favorite for travelers seeking cultural depth, technological marvels, and natural beauty. For 2026-2027, Japan continues to be a top destination for those who appreciate order, beauty, and a distinct way of life.
Cultural Immersion: Temples, Shrines, and Geishas
The spiritual heart of Japan beats in its countless temples and shrines, from the serene Zen gardens of Kyoto to the iconic Fushimi Inari Shrine. Experiencing a traditional tea ceremony, witnessing a sumo wrestling match, or perhaps catching a glimpse of geishas in Gion district offers a profound connection to Japanese heritage. The meticulous attention to detail in Japanese arts and crafts is evident everywhere.
Technological Marvels and Urban Exploration
Japan is a global leader in technology and innovation. Tokyo, a sprawling metropolis, showcases this with its futuristic architecture, efficient public transport, and vibrant pop culture. Exploring districts like Shibuya and Shinjuku, experiencing the bullet train (Shinkansen), and visiting technology hubs provide a glimpse into the country’s forward-thinking spirit.
Natural Beauty: From Cherry Blossoms to Mount Fuji
Beyond its bustling cities, Japan boasts stunning natural landscapes. The iconic Mount Fuji, the serene bamboo forests of Arashiyama, the tropical islands of Okinawa, and the vibrant autumn foliage across the country offer diverse scenic beauty. Cherry blossom viewing (hanami) in spring and autumn color appreciation are major seasonal draws.
Navigating Japan in 2026-2027
The Japan Rail Pass is an excellent option for exploring multiple cities efficiently. For 2026-2027, consider visiting during spring for cherry blossoms or autumn for fall colors. Popular routes include Tokyo-Kyoto-Osaka, with potential extensions to Hakone for Mount Fuji views or Hiroshima for historical reflection. Planning accommodation, especially in popular cities, is advisable well in advance.
3. New Zealand: Adventure Capital of the World
New Zealand is synonymous with adventure and impressive natural beauty. Its dramatic landscapes, from snow-capped mountains and pristine fjords to geothermal wonders and lush rainforests, provide an unparalleled playground for outdoor enthusiasts. For 2026-2027, its commitment to conservation and sustainable tourism makes it an even more attractive destination.
Adrenaline-Pumping Activities
New Zealand is the birthplace of commercial bungee jumping and offers a vast array of adrenaline-fueled activities. White-water rafting, skydiving, jet boating, zip-lining, and canyoning are popular choices across the country. Queenstown, in particular, is renowned as the adventure capital.
Spectacular Scenery and National Parks
The diversity of New Zealand’s scenery is astounding. Fiordland National Park, home to Milford Sound and Doubtful Sound, offers majestic fjords and waterfalls. The geothermal areas of Rotorua, the glaciers of the West Coast, and the beaches of the Coromandel Peninsula are just a few examples of its natural splendor. Hiking and trekking are central to the New Zealand experience, with numerous Great Walks offering spectacular routes.
Maori Culture and Unique Wildlife
Beyond its landscapes, New Zealand offers a rich cultural experience through its indigenous Maori heritage. Visitors can experience traditional performances, learn about Maori art and history, and visit sacred sites. The country is also home to unique wildlife, including the kiwi bird, fur seals, and dolphins, often encountered on boat tours or nature walks.
Planning Your New Zealand Expedition in 2026-2027
For 2026-2027, consider a road trip using a campervan or rental car to fully appreciate the diverse landscapes. The North Island offers geothermal wonders and beaches, while the South Island is ideal for dramatic mountain scenery and adventure sports. Booking popular Great Walks and accommodations in advance is highly recommended, especially for peak season travel (December-February).
4. France: Romance, Culture, and Culinary Excellence
France consistently ranks among the world’s most visited countries, celebrated for its iconic landmarks, sophisticated culture, world-class art, and exquisite cuisine. Its enduring charm lies in its ability to offer a diverse range of experiences, from the romantic allure of Paris to the sun-drenched vineyards of Provence and the historic beaches of Normandy.
Iconic Landmarks and Parisian Charm
Paris, the City of Light, is a global icon, drawing visitors to the Eiffel Tower, the Louvre Museum, Notre Dame Cathedral, and the charming streets of Montmartre. Beyond the capital, France boasts a rich mix of historical cities, chateaux-laden countryside, and charming villages, each with its unique character.
Art, Fashion, and Literature
France has long been a center for arts, fashion, and literature. Museums like the Musée d’Orsay and the Centre Pompidou in Paris, along with countless galleries and historical sites across the country, offer profound cultural insights. The country’s influence on global fashion and its rich literary history add further layers to its cultural appeal.
Gastronomy and Wine Regions
French cuisine and wine are legendary. From Michelin-starred restaurants to cozy bistros, the culinary landscape is diverse and exceptional. Exploring renowned wine regions like Bordeaux, Burgundy, and Champagne offers a chance to taste world-class wines and understand the terroir that shapes them. Regional specialties, like the pastries of Alsace or the seafood of Brittany, provide endless gastronomic delights.
Exploring France in 2026-2027
For 2026-2027, consider combining a Parisian city break with a tour of the Loire Valley chateaux, a relaxing stay in Provence, or exploring the wine routes. Traveling by train is an efficient and scenic way to see the country. The shoulder seasons (spring and autumn) offer pleasant weather and fewer crowds, making them ideal for exploring both cities and the countryside.
5. Peru: Ancient Civilizations and Andean Majesty
Peru offers an extraordinary journey into the heart of ancient civilizations and spectacular natural landscapes. It is a destination that resonates with history buffs, adventure seekers, and those looking for profound cultural encounters. For 2026-2027, Peru continues to be a must-visit for its iconic sites and vibrant living culture.
Machu Picchu and the Sacred Valley
The crown jewel of Peru is undoubtedly Machu Picchu, the impressive Inca citadel perched high in the Andes. The journey to Machu Picchu, often via the scenic Sacred Valley, is an experience in itself, passing through charming villages and ancient ruins like Ollantaytambo and Pisac. The Inca Trail and alternative treks offer challenging yet rewarding ways to reach this wonder.
Rich History and Archaeological Treasures
Beyond Machu Picchu, Peru is dotted with archaeological sites that tell the story of pre-Inca civilizations. From the Nazca Lines etched into the desert floor to the ancient city of Caral and the colonial architecture of Cusco, the country’s history is palpable. Exploring these sites provides a deep understanding of Peru’s complex past.
Andean Landscapes and Biodiversity
The Andes Mountains dominate Peru’s interior, offering stunning vistas, diverse ecosystems, and opportunities for trekking and mountaineering. Lake Titicaca, the world’s highest navigable lake, with its unique Uros floating islands, is another major draw. The Amazon rainforest, covering a significant portion of the country, offers incredible biodiversity and wildlife viewing opportunities.
Planning Your Peruvian Expedition in 2026-2027
For 2026-2027, booking Machu Picchu entrance tickets and train/trek permits well in advance is crucial, especially for the high season (May-September). Consider acclimatizing to the altitude in Cusco before heading to Machu Picchu. Combining the Andes with a visit to the Amazon or the coastal desert offers a well-rounded Peruvian experience.
6. Thailand: Vibrant Culture, Stunning Beaches, and Delicious Cuisine
Thailand, the “Land of Smiles,” is a perennial favorite for its welcoming culture, stunning natural beauty, and incredible value for money. It offers a dynamic mix of bustling cities, serene temples, lush jungles, and idyllic islands, making it a top choice for diverse tourist experiences in 2026-2027.
Cultural Heartbeat: Temples and Traditions
Bangkok, the capital, is a sensory explosion, brimming with ornate temples like Wat Arun and Wat Pho, vibrant street markets, and a lively nightlife. Beyond the capital, ancient cities like Ayutthaya and Sukhothai offer glimpses into Thailand’s rich history. The gentle nature of Thai people and their deep-rooted Buddhist traditions create a unique and welcoming atmosphere.
Island Paradises and Coastal Escapes
Thailand’s southern coastlines are famous for their picture-perfect islands and beaches. Phuket, Koh Samui, Koh Phi Phi, and Krabi offer everything from lively beach resorts and diving hotspots to secluded coves and dramatic limestone karsts. Snorkeling, diving, kayaking, and simply relaxing on white-sand beaches are popular pursuits.
Culinary Delights and Street Food Culture
Thai cuisine is celebrated globally for its bold flavors, balancing sweet, sour, salty, and spicy notes. From street food stalls serving Pad Thai and green curry to upscale restaurants, the culinary scene is diverse and affordable. Taking a Thai cooking class is a highly recommended activity for an in-depth gastronomic experience.
Exploring Thailand in 2026-2027
For 2026-2027, consider visiting during the cool, dry season (November-February) for the best weather. A popular itinerary might include Bangkok for culture and city life, Chiang Mai for elephants and northern traditions, and a southern island for beach relaxation. Budget travelers can find excellent value, while luxury options abound, making Thailand accessible to a wide range of visitors.
7. Canada: Vast Wilderness and Multicultural Cities
Canada is a land of immense natural beauty and vibrant multicultural cities, offering a diverse range of experiences that appeal to adventurers, nature lovers, and urban explorers alike. Its vast landscapes, from the Rocky Mountains to the Atlantic coast, combined with its welcoming cities, make it a top destination for 2026-2027.
Majestic Mountain Landscapes
The Canadian Rockies, particularly Banff and Jasper National Parks, are legendary for their turquoise lakes, towering peaks, and abundant wildlife. Hiking, skiing, wildlife viewing, and scenic drives are prime activities. The West Coast province of British Columbia also offers stunning coastal mountains and lush rainforests.
Vibrant Multicultural Cities
Canada’s cities are known for their diversity and quality of life. Toronto pulsates with a global energy, Vancouver offers a stunning blend of urban life and natural beauty, Montreal delights with its European flair and French-Canadian culture, and Calgary provides a gateway to the Rockies with its Western heritage.
Unique Wildlife and Coastal Wonders
From whale watching on the Pacific coast to spotting bears and moose in the wilderness, Canada offers incredible wildlife encounters. The East Coast provinces, like Nova Scotia and Newfoundland, boast dramatic coastlines, charming fishing villages, and a rich maritime history.
Planning Your Canadian Adventure in 2026-2027
For 2026-2027, consider a summer trip for hiking and exploring national parks, or a winter visit for skiing and experiencing festive city lights. A road trip along the Icefields Parkway or exploring the diverse regions from coast to coast are popular choices. Booking accommodations and popular tours, especially in national parks, is recommended well in advance for peak seasons.
8. Spain: Passion, History, and Diverse Regions
Spain captivates visitors with its passionate culture, rich history, diverse landscapes, and vibrant cities. From the Moorish architecture of Andalusia to the artistic hubs of Barcelona and Madrid, and the sun-drenched islands, Spain offers a compelling blend of experiences for 2026-2027 travelers.
Architectural Marvels and Historical Depth
Spain’s history is reflected in its stunning architecture. The Alhambra in Granada, the Sagrada Familia in Barcelona, the Mezquita of Cordoba, and the ancient Roman aqueduct in Segovia are just a few examples. Exploring historic cities like Seville, Toledo, and Santiago de Compostela provides a deep look at the country’s past.
Vibrant City Life and Artistic Heritage
Spanish cities pulse with energy. Barcelona offers Gaudí’s whimsical designs and a lively Mediterranean vibe, while Madrid boasts world-class art museums like the Prado and Reina Sofía, along with a dynamic culinary scene. Valencia, Seville, and Bilbao each offer unique cultural experiences and culinary specialties.
Diverse Landscapes and Island Escapes
Spain’s geography is incredibly varied. The northern regions offer lush green landscapes and a cooler climate, while the south is known for its arid beauty and flamenco culture. The Balearic and Canary Islands provide idyllic beach holidays, hiking opportunities, and unique volcanic landscapes.
Experiencing Spain in 2026-2027
For 2026-2027, consider visiting during the spring or autumn for pleasant weather across most regions. A popular itinerary might include exploring the art and energy of Madrid and Barcelona, experiencing the history and passion of Andalusia, or relaxing on the islands. Tapas tours and wine tasting are essential culinary experiences.
9. Costa Rica: Ecotourism and Biodiversity Hotspot
Costa Rica is a global leader in ecotourism, celebrated for its commitment to conservation, incredible biodiversity, and abundant opportunities for adventure in stunning natural settings. It’s a paradise for nature lovers and thrill-seekers planning for 2026-2027.
Rainforests, Volcanoes, and Wildlife
The country is home to lush rainforests teeming with wildlife, including monkeys, sloths, toucans, and vibrant insects. Cloud forests like Monteverde offer unique ecosystems, while active volcanoes like Arenal provide dramatic landscapes and hot springs. National parks protect a significant portion of the country’s natural heritage.
Adventure Activities Galore
Costa Rica is an adventurer’s dream. Ziplining through the canopy, white-water rafting on pristine rivers, surfing world-class breaks, hiking volcanic trails, and exploring hanging bridges are just some of the activities available. The focus is on experiencing nature actively and sustainably.
Pura Vida Lifestyle and Pristine Beaches
The national motto, “Pura Vida” (pure life), encapsulates the relaxed and joyful attitude of Costa Ricans. This philosophy extends to its beautiful coastlines, offering both Pacific and Caribbean beaches perfect for surfing, swimming, or simply unwinding. Eco-lodges and sustainable tourism practices are central to the visitor experience.
Planning Your Costa Rican Eco-Adventure in 2026-2027
For 2026-2027, the dry season (December-April) is popular for beach activities and hiking, while the green season (May-November) offers lush landscapes and fewer crowds, with rain often occurring in the afternoons. Combining different regions like La Fortuna (volcanoes and adventure), Monteverde (cloud forest), and a coastal area (beaches and wildlife) provides a comprehensive experience.
10. Tanzania: The Ultimate Safari and Cultural Experience
Tanzania stands out as a premier destination for unparalleled wildlife encounters, impressive natural landscapes, and rich cultural experiences. It offers the quintessential African safari, making it a top choice for travelers seeking adventure and natural wonder in 2026-2027.
The Serengeti and Great Migration
The Serengeti National Park is world-renowned for its vast plains and the spectacular Great Migration, where millions of wildebeest, zebras, and gazelles traverse the ecosystem in search of fresh grazing. Witnessing this natural phenomenon is a highlight for many visitors. Nearby, the Ngorongoro Conservation Area offers a unique caldera teeming with wildlife.
Mount Kilimanjaro: Africa’s Highest Peak
For trekkers and adventurers, climbing Mount Kilimanjaro, the Roof of Africa, is a challenging yet immensely rewarding experience. Various routes cater to different fitness levels, offering a journey through diverse ecological zones to the summit. Successful ascents provide unforgettable views and a profound sense of achievement.
Zanzibar’s Spice Islands and Cultural Heritage
Off the coast of mainland Tanzania lies Zanzibar, an archipelago famed for its spice plantations, pristine white-sand beaches, and the historic Stone Town, a UNESCO World Heritage site. It offers a perfect blend of relaxation, cultural exploration, and water activities like snorkeling and diving.
Planning Your Tanzanian Adventure in 2026-2027
For 2026-2027, the best time for a Serengeti safari often aligns with the Great Migration, typically June to October and December to March. Climbing Kilimanjaro is possible year-round but has optimal windows. Customizable safari packages, including luxury tented camps and budget-friendly options, are available. For a comprehensive experience, combining a safari with a Kilimanjaro trek and a Zanzibar beach holiday is highly recommended.
